Freighting OTA interstate - advice sought

I'm looking to ship an SN10 ota from Melbourne to Brisbane. I'm looking for advice from members experienced in shipping large OTAs interstate. Who did you use, how was it packed, did it arrive in one piece?

I have had 3 good experiences with pack and send. You can book online either for pick up or drop off at your closest depot. You can choose an insurance option, but the very helpful person at my local depot told me that the terms and conditions specifically exclude scientific instruments unless Pack and Send have packed the item themselves.

Another vote for Pack & Send. BNE-MEL
I had them pack the OTA. Fully insured.

I did take a few pics on my phone in the presence of the rep b4 dispatch.
I also had the recipient worded up on a thorough inspection of the box exterior for dents or crumpled corners, and of course the OTA whilst still at the destination depot.

No issues though. I highly recommend them.

Just be aware that Pack&Send Online is in no way linked to the local depots,
they are completely different businesses and they also have restrictions on what they will carry (check fragile items).
The P&S depots are only a pick up and drop off point for the Online business and they make no income from the online parcels.
